Re: [PATCH v2 008/110] jbd2: use PRIino format for i_ino

2026-03-03 Thread Jan Kara
On Mon 02-03-26 15:23:52, Jeff Layton wrote:
> Convert jbd2 i_ino format strings to use the PRIino format
> macro in preparation for the widening of i_ino via kino_t.
> 
> Also correct signed format specifiers to unsigned, since inode
> numbers are unsigned values.
> 
> Signed-off-by: Jeff Layton 

Looks good. Feel free to add:

Reviewed-by: Jan Kara 

Honza


> ---
>  fs/jbd2/journal.c | 4 ++--
>  fs/jbd2/transaction.c | 2 +-
>  2 files changed, 3 insertions(+), 3 deletions(-)
> 
> diff --git a/fs/jbd2/journal.c b/fs/jbd2/journal.c
> index 
> cb2c529a8f1bea33df6d4135e5782b9a77792732..9df937f0e15c71028038e1c0c12159421a2444b4
>  100644
> --- a/fs/jbd2/journal.c
> +++ b/fs/jbd2/journal.c
> @@ -1677,7 +1677,7 @@ journal_t *jbd2_journal_init_inode(struct inode *inode)
>   return err ? ERR_PTR(err) : ERR_PTR(-EINVAL);
>   }
>  
> - jbd2_debug(1, "JBD2: inode %s/%ld, size %lld, bits %d, blksize %ld\n",
> + jbd2_debug(1, "JBD2: inode %s/%" PRIino "u, size %lld, bits %d, blksize 
> %ld\n",
> inode->i_sb->s_id, inode->i_ino, (long long) inode->i_size,
> inode->i_sb->s_blocksize_bits, inode->i_sb->s_blocksize);
>  
> @@ -1689,7 +1689,7 @@ journal_t *jbd2_journal_init_inode(struct inode *inode)
>  
>   journal->j_inode = inode;
>   snprintf(journal->j_devname, sizeof(journal->j_devname),
> -  "%pg-%lu", journal->j_dev, journal->j_inode->i_ino);
> +  "%pg-%" PRIino "u", journal->j_dev, journal->j_inode->i_ino);
>   strreplace(journal->j_devname, '/', '!');
>   jbd2_stats_proc_init(journal);
>  
> diff --git a/fs/jbd2/transaction.c b/fs/jbd2/transaction.c
> index 
> dca4b5d83e1505b09fab42eb45bb201a8db8..2a03d4eafdee95e5caa8dbd0afe4e32ef4104378
>  100644
> --- a/fs/jbd2/transaction.c
> +++ b/fs/jbd2/transaction.c
> @@ -2651,7 +2651,7 @@ static int jbd2_journal_file_inode(handle_t *handle, 
> struct jbd2_inode *jinode,
>   return -EROFS;
>   journal = transaction->t_journal;
>  
> - jbd2_debug(4, "Adding inode %lu, tid:%d\n", jinode->i_vfs_inode->i_ino,
> + jbd2_debug(4, "Adding inode %" PRIino "u, tid:%d\n", 
> jinode->i_vfs_inode->i_ino,
>   transaction->t_tid);
>  
>   spin_lock(&journal->j_list_lock);
> 
> -- 
> 2.53.0
> 
-- 
Jan Kara 
SUSE Labs, CR


[PATCH v2 008/110] jbd2: use PRIino format for i_ino

2026-03-03 Thread Jeff Layton
Convert jbd2 i_ino format strings to use the PRIino format
macro in preparation for the widening of i_ino via kino_t.

Also correct signed format specifiers to unsigned, since inode
numbers are unsigned values.

Signed-off-by: Jeff Layton 
---
 fs/jbd2/journal.c | 4 ++--
 fs/jbd2/transaction.c | 2 +-
 2 files changed, 3 insertions(+), 3 deletions(-)

diff --git a/fs/jbd2/journal.c b/fs/jbd2/journal.c
index 
cb2c529a8f1bea33df6d4135e5782b9a77792732..9df937f0e15c71028038e1c0c12159421a2444b4
 100644
--- a/fs/jbd2/journal.c
+++ b/fs/jbd2/journal.c
@@ -1677,7 +1677,7 @@ journal_t *jbd2_journal_init_inode(struct inode *inode)
return err ? ERR_PTR(err) : ERR_PTR(-EINVAL);
}
 
-   jbd2_debug(1, "JBD2: inode %s/%ld, size %lld, bits %d, blksize %ld\n",
+   jbd2_debug(1, "JBD2: inode %s/%" PRIino "u, size %lld, bits %d, blksize 
%ld\n",
  inode->i_sb->s_id, inode->i_ino, (long long) inode->i_size,
  inode->i_sb->s_blocksize_bits, inode->i_sb->s_blocksize);
 
@@ -1689,7 +1689,7 @@ journal_t *jbd2_journal_init_inode(struct inode *inode)
 
journal->j_inode = inode;
snprintf(journal->j_devname, sizeof(journal->j_devname),
-"%pg-%lu", journal->j_dev, journal->j_inode->i_ino);
+"%pg-%" PRIino "u", journal->j_dev, journal->j_inode->i_ino);
strreplace(journal->j_devname, '/', '!');
jbd2_stats_proc_init(journal);
 
diff --git a/fs/jbd2/transaction.c b/fs/jbd2/transaction.c
index 
dca4b5d83e1505b09fab42eb45bb201a8db8..2a03d4eafdee95e5caa8dbd0afe4e32ef4104378
 100644
--- a/fs/jbd2/transaction.c
+++ b/fs/jbd2/transaction.c
@@ -2651,7 +2651,7 @@ static int jbd2_journal_file_inode(handle_t *handle, 
struct jbd2_inode *jinode,
return -EROFS;
journal = transaction->t_journal;
 
-   jbd2_debug(4, "Adding inode %lu, tid:%d\n", jinode->i_vfs_inode->i_ino,
+   jbd2_debug(4, "Adding inode %" PRIino "u, tid:%d\n", 
jinode->i_vfs_inode->i_ino,
transaction->t_tid);
 
spin_lock(&journal->j_list_lock);

-- 
2.53.0